我對asp.net mvc應用程序使用亞音速存儲庫模式(2.1)。在我的應用程序中,有許多存儲庫,如categoryRepository,Blogrepository等。在每個存儲庫中,我將調用subsonic的DB.Select().From()...ExecuteReader(),然後從這些reader中加載域對象。 在控制器操作中,我從這些存儲庫多次調用例如 List<IBlog> blog
我在開發中使用亞音速simplerepo與遷移,它使事情變得很容易,但我一直遇到問題與我的nvarchar有索引的列。我的用戶表有顯而易見的原因username列定義的索引,但每次我啓動項目亞音速是這樣做的: ALTER TABLE [Users] ALTER COLUMN Username nvarchar(50);
這將導致此: The index 'IX_Username' is dep
我在MySQL數據庫中有一個名爲'Key'的專欄。似乎 repo.Find<Class>(x=>x.Key.StartsWith("BLAH"));
生成的SQL代碼 WHERE Key LIKE 'BLAH%'
,而不是正確的像 WHERE `Key` LIKE 'BLAH%'
我怎樣才能迫使後來的行爲(是亞音速的錯誤嗎?)
出於某種原因,我的類上的TimeSpan屬性未被Subsonic持久保存到數據庫中,因此僅僅被忽略!所有其他屬性正在保存好。我正在使用SimpleRepository和RunMigrations,Subsonic v3.0.0.3。 public TimeSpan Time { get; set; }
是否支持TimeSpans?
我是C#和亞音速的新手。我試圖解決以下情況: public class UnknownInt {
public int val;
public bool known;
}
public class Record {
public int ID;
public UnknownInt data;
}
我正在使用SimpleRepository。 有沒